615883687 https://github.com/dogsheep/github-to-sqlite/issues/28#issuecomment-615883687 https://api.github.com/repos/dogsheep/github-to-sqlite/issues/28 MDEyOklzc3VlQ29tbWVudDYxNTg4MzY4Nw== simonw 9599 2020-04-18T14:49:58Z 2020-04-18T14:49:58Z MEMBER That happened trying to pull contributors for `dogsheep/beta` - an empty repository. Turns out it was returning a `204 no content`: ``` ~ $ curl -i 'https://api.github.com/repos/dogsheep/beta/contributors' HTTP/1.1 204 No Content ``` {"total_count": 0, "+1": 0, "-1": 0, "laugh": 0, "hooray": 0, "confused": 0, "heart": 0, "rocket": 0, "eyes": 0} Pull repository contributors 601333634
